Whitewood Close is in Ashton In Makerfield, Wigan and in Wigan district. WN4 8ED is located in the Bryn with Ashton-in-Makerfield North elect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Makerfield. This postcode has been in use since 1992-08-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The local area around WN4 8ED is generally consistent with those figures, having a male population of 49.4%.

2011202110y change (pp)UK Averagepostcode vs UK (pp)
Female51.7%50.6%-1.1% 51.0% -0.4%
Male48.3%49.4%1.1% 49.0% 0.4%

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of WN4 8ED there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 53.3%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

2011202110y change (pp)UK Averagepostcode vs UK (pp)
Single30.2%30.7%0.5% 37.9% -7.2%
Married: Opposite sex51.2%53.3%2.1% 44.2% 9.1%
Separated3.2%2.6%-0.6% 2.2% 0.4%
Divorced10.5%9.1%-1.4% 9.1% 0.0%
Widowed4.9%4.4%-0.5% 6.1% -1.7%

Employment

WN4 8ED area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
